Basic info on Opel Astra 1.7 CDTi

The German car was first shown in year 1998 and powered by a 4 - cylinder turbo diesel unit, produced by Isuzu. The engine offers a displacement of 1.7 litre matched to a front wheel drive system and a manual gearbox with 5 or a automatic gearbox with 4 gears. Vehicle in question is a small family car with the top speed of 173km/h, reaching the 100km/h (62mph) mark in 14.0s and consuming around 4.6 liters of fuel every 100 kilometers.
